Course Information

This nationally recognised certificate will give you practical skills and ensure you are job-ready to work in animal shelters, kennels, catteries, sanctuaries or veterinary clinics.

Gain administrative skills related to the animal care industry, how to maintain records, and provide reception services and communications.

Through the online course and Structured Workplace Learning and Assessment (SWLA), you will also learn the critical necessities of animal care – from proper feeding, and correct hygiene practices to emergency response and providing basic first aid to animals.

  • 12 months

  • Online with Structure Workplace Learning and Assessment (SWLA)

  • How to work with people and animals in the animal care industry
  • Animal industry-related administration
  • Practical feeding and hygiene skills
  • Emergency response and first aid

Eligibility

  • There are no academic prerequisite requirements for this course. However, students must be 18 years of age or above.

Work Placement

  • Structured Workplace Learning and Assessment (SWLA) in this course is completed in 2 blocks and each block covers 6 units of competency.
  • Block 1 requires a minimum of 54 hours of placement in approved facilities, and Block 2 requires 50 hours of placement in approved facilities.
